Meaning of Kesari

Kesari derives from the Sanskrit word ‘kesara’ (केसर), which has two primary meanings: ‘saffron’ (the precious spice) and ‘mane of a lion’. From ‘kesara’, the form ‘kesari’ evolved to mean ‘saffron-colored’ or directly ‘lion’. In botanical contexts, ‘kesara’ refers to the stigma of the saffron crocus, while in zoological terms, it denotes the majestic mane of a lion. This dual symbolism connects the name to both natural beauty (saffron’s color) and raw power (the lion’s strength). Linguistically, it’s a straightforward derivation with no complex compound elements, making its meaning clear and well-documented in Sanskrit literature.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Kesari originates from classical Sanskrit, an ancient Indo-Aryan language foundational to Hindu scriptures and Indian culture. It appears in Hindu mythology as the name of Hanuman’s father, Kesari, a vanara king known for his valor and loyalty. The name is used across India and Nepal, particularly in Hindu communities, though it’s not tied to a specific region. While primarily a Hindu name, its Sanskrit roots mean it’s occasionally used by Jains and Buddhists in South Asia. The name’s association with saffron—a sacred color in Hinduism—and the lion—a symbol of royalty and power—ensures its enduring cultural relevance.

Famous People Named Kesari

  • Kesari Singh Barhath — Indian freedom fighter and revolutionary from Rajasthan
  • Kesari — Father of Hanuman in Hindu mythology, a vanara king known for his strength
